V$INSTANCE

V$INSTANCE视图提供了当前数据库实例的状态信息。

简介

V$INSTANCEPolarDB PostgreSQL版(兼容Oracle)中的一个动态性能视图,它提供了当前数据库实例的状态信息。该视图包含了关于数据库实例的一些关键信息,例如,实例的名称、启动时间、版本信息、主机名等。动态性能视图通常以V$开头,它们提供了对数据库当前性能和运行状态的实时视图。V$INSTANCE视图是用于监控和管理数据库实例的一个重要工具。

V$INSTANCE视图包含以下列信息:

列名称

类型

描述

INSTANCE_NUMBER

numeric

实例的编号。

INSTANCE_NAME

character varying(16)

实例名称,通常与数据库名称相同。

HOST_NAME

character varying(16)

运行数据库实例的服务器主机名。

VERSION

character varying(17)

数据库的版本号。

STARTUP_TIME

date

实例最后一次启动的时间。

STATUS

character varying(12)

实例当前的状态。例如 "OPEN"、"MOUNTED"、"STARTED" 等。

PARALLEL

character varying(3)

表示实例是否运行在并行模式。

THREAD#

numeric

实例的线程编号。

ARCHIVER

character varying(7)

归档进程的状态。

LOG_SWITCH_WAIT

character varying(15)

日志切换等待情况。

DATABASE_STATUS

character varying(17)

数据库的状态。例如 "ACTIVE"、"SUSPENDED" 等。

INSTANCE_ROLE

text

实例的角色。例如 "PRIMARY INSTANCE"、"SECONDARY INSTANCE" 等。

该视图对于确定数据库实例的健康状况和配置非常有用。例如,高权限用户可以通过查看V$INSTANCE来确认数据库实例是否处于打开状态以及当前是否可用。